Key Features
- Approximately 3 ft in length: long enough for comfortable routing inside a vehicle while keeping connectors accessible without excess slack.
- Total Shield RF Blocking: reduces radio frequency interference for clearer headset audio when used near transmitters and intercom bases.
- Molded OFFROAD plug: built to resist dirt and mechanical stress typical of off road environments to maintain reliable connections.
- High bend test cord: constructed to resist repeated flexing so the cord lasts longer under heavy use and movement.
- Universal 5-pin headset plug: lets users connect standard 5-pin headsets to off road intercom cables without rewiring or custom adapters.
- Wide compatibility: works with Rugged Radios, PCI Race Radios, Avcomm, RacerX and other off road intercom systems for broad fleet or team use.
Who It's For
This adapter is aimed at off road riders, pit crews, and rally teams that use established intercom systems and need to attach standard 5-pin headsets quickly and securely. It is a practical pick for anyone who values interference-free audio and a cord that can stand up to outdoor and vehicular use.
Users who should look elsewhere include those needing longer custom cable runs, integrated headset/microphone assemblies that use nonstandard pinouts, or helmet-specific wiring solutions; this adapter is a simple, straight cord rather than a complete headset or custom loom.

Specifications
| Product | CS-3H-OF Off Road Nexus to 5-Pin Adapter Cord |
| Length | Approximately 3 ft |
| Shielding | Total Shield RF blocking |
| Connector A | Molded Off Road Nexus female jack compatible |
| Connector B | Universal 5-pin headset plug |
| Durability | High bend test cord with molded plug |

Frequently Asked Questions
Will this work with non-Rugged Radios intercoms?
Yes, it is compatible with PCI Race Radios, Avcomm, RacerX and other off road intercoms that use the same Nexus jack and 5-pin headset standard.
How long is the cord?
The cord is approximately 3 ft in length, suited for vehicle interior routing and short connections.
Does the adapter prevent interference?
It features total shield RF blocking to reduce radio frequency interference for clearer headset audio.
